Elmcrest Country Club

Elmcrest Country Club is a 18-hole private golf course in East Longmeadow, Massachusetts, built in 1967. Green fees run $20.00 on weekdays and $28.00 on weekends. The layout features Bent Grass fairways and Bent Grass greens, 31-40 bunkers, water hazards in play. The course is open apr 1 to nov 30, soft spikes required. The course handles approximately 30,000 rounds per year, serving the local East Longmeadow golf community. Elmcrest Country Club offers a private club experience in East Longmeadow, Massachusetts.

When are the greens aerated at Elmcrest Country Club?

Aeration is needed to keep the greens healthy and involves placing small holes in the greens to allow air, water, and nutrients to reach the roots. The greens at Elmcrest Country Club are aerated in May and September.
